titleOfInvention | Radiation-sensitive composition for color filter and color filter using the same |
abstract | PROBLEM TO BE SOLVED: To provide a radiation-sensitive composition for a color filter and a color filter which exhibit good developability even when a colorant is contained at a high concentration and can provide a highly reliable display element. I do. SOLUTION: The radiation-sensitive composition for a color filter comprises (A) a colorant, (B) a copolymer of an isocyanate compound represented by the following structural formula (1) and another copolymerizable monomer. Including an alkali-soluble resin, (C) a multi-sensitive monomer, And (D) a photopolymerization initiator. The color filter has a colored layer obtained by curing the radiation-sensitive composition. Embedded image [In the structural formula (1), R 1 represents a hydrogen atom or a methyl group, and R 2 represents an alkylene group having 1 to 18 carbon atoms. ] |
